This report is the result of a comprehensive review of statewide plans nationwide. The review also produced a database with detailed information on major characteristics of the statewide plans. The goals of the research were to assess how individual states approach a series of important transportation planning themes in their plans; to identify national planning trends from this analysis; and to highlight "noteworthy practices". The report is organized into modules covering eight topics: Financial planning; Freight transportation; Goals and performance measures; Major issues and challenges facing the state; Plan cycle; Public involvement; Relationships between state departments of transportation and other governmental agencies; and Safety.
